Course structure

• Foundations of Sustainable Infrastructure
• Principles of Effective Mentoring
•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and Infrastructure
• Leadership and Communication in Mentoring
• Ethical Practices in Mentoring and Infrastructure
• Project Management for Sustainable Infrastructure
•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ration
• Monitoring and Evaluation of Sustainable Projects
• Innovation and Technology in Infrastructure Development
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Sustainable Infrastructure

Career path

Sustainability Consultant: Advises on eco-friendly practices and sustainable development strategies for infrastructure projects.

Infrastructure Project Manager: Oversees the planning and execution of sustainable infrastructure projects, ensuring alignment with environmental goals.

Environmental Engineer: Designs and implements solutions to minimize environmental impact in infrastructure development.

Green Building Specialist: Focuses on energy-efficient and sustainable building designs, aligning with green certification standards.

Renewable Energy Analyst: Evaluates and optimizes renewable energy solutions for sustainable infrastructure projects.
